National Science Foundation
Graduate S-STEM Award
The UW - La Crosse Computer Science
Department has been awarded a National Science Foundation
grant ($526,000 over 5 years) in the S-STEM program.
Further details, including the application process,
can be found at http://www.cs.uwlax.edu/S-STEM.
National Science Foundation
Undergraduate
S-STEM Award
The UW - La Crosse Computer Science
Department and the Electronic and Computer Engineering
Technology Program at Western Technical College has
been awarded a National Science foundation grant ($597,000
over 5 years) in the S-STEM program. Further details,
including the application process, can be found at
http://www.cs.uwlax.edu/UGSSTEM.html.

Employment Outlook
The U.S. Department of Labor reports
in its Occupational Outlook
Handbook 2008-09 Edition, which covers the
2006-2016 decade, that Computer Software
Engineers will remain in high demand. The most
recent report says
"Job prospects should be excellent, as
computer software engineers are expected to be among the
fastest-growing occupations through the year 2016."
"Employment of computer software engineers
is projected to increase by 38 percent over the 2006-2016
period, which is much faster than the average for all occupations."
"According to Robert Half technology,
starting salaries for software engineers in software development
ranged from $66,500 to $99.750 in 2007."
